From a traditional grid to a market –oriented, smart grid

The transmission grid : public ownership of the State; 49 years concession agreement for Transelectrtica

CEI Summit Economic Forum

Transmission network and interconnection lines.

Transelectrica operates 8947.1 km

Over Head Lines (OHL) :• 154. 6km with 750 kV

• 4,626 km with 400 kV• 4,128.5 km with 220kV• 38 km with 110 kV

Transelectrica operates 77 substations in Romania

• 1 w ith 750 kV

• 32 with 400 kV• 44 with 220 kV

CEI Summit Economic Forum

Capacity and variety of generation.

Generating capacity1. Installed generating capacity: 20 422 MW 100 %

2. Installed hydro capacity: 6 414 MW 31 %

3. Installed coal capacity: 7 278 MW 36 %

4. Installed gas & oil capacity: 5 306 MW 26 %

5. Installed nuclear capacity: 1 413 MW 6.9 %

6. Installed wind capacity: 11 MW 0.1 %

Average consumption: Request for huge wind installed capacity (more than 20 000 MW)
